利用MSSQL快速创建试图(mssql创建试图)

2023-04-21 13:55:28 创建 利用 试图

试图(View)是一种虚拟表,它不是存储在你的数据库中,就像关系表可以存储记录一样,但是它可以并不实际存在,只是一个结构化查询语言(Structured Query Language,简写为SQL)的语法,以及它引用的表的。由于试图的结构与表的结构类似,它易于遵循结构化编程和数据库定义语言(DDL)。

Microsoft SQL Server (MSSQL) 之间是一个熟练的关系型数据库,它在应用程序中使用查询结构化查询语言(SQL)来存取和管理数据。利用MSSQL来快速创建试图涉及到以下步骤:

一,指定2020表:

我们需要指定一个基本表来定义图,例如:

CREATE TABLE [dbo].[Products_2020](

[ProductID] [int] IDENTITY(1,1) NOT NULL,

[ProductName] [nvarchar](50) NULL,

[Dimension] [int] NULL

) ON [PRIMARY]

二,创建视图:

使用CREATE VIEW语句指定视图的列名和表的连接定义:

CREATE VIEW [V_Products_2020]

AS

SELECT a.ProductID, a.ProductName, a.Dimension

FROM dbo.Products_2020 a

三,确认视图:

现在我们可以使用SELECT语句查看新创建的试图:

SELECT * FROM V_Products_2020

四,更新试图:

当我们更新了Products_2020表的内容以后,试图自动更新:

UPDATE dbo.Products_2020

SET Dimension = 2

WHERE ProductID = 1

五,确认更新:

接着我们可以再次使用SELECT语句查看被更新的Products_2020表:

SELECT * FROM V_Products_2020

从上面的步骤中我们可以看到,利用MSSQL我们可以快速地创建试图,并且自动更新,以及查看被更新的内容。试图对于数据分析和查询数据库很有用,而且使用MSSQL我们可以快速创建,这使得快速开发和布置架构更容易。

相关文章